Your new role

  • Degree in Electrical Engineering or related field
  • Design of generator control systems and associated equipment
  • Updating and managing wiring schematics.
  • Technical Calculations.
  • Component / sub-systems supplier review.
  • Experience with programming Deep Sea and Comap genset controllers would be an advantage.
  • Knowledge of Controller Area Network (CAN bus) would be an advantage.
  • Liaison with inhouse panel shop personnel on the assembly / manufacture of products.
  • Complete and apply basic training on engineering standards.
  • Generator upgrades, including but not limited to control panels.
  • Paralleling generator systems.
  • Generator Load Testing.
  • Generator commissioning
  • Knowledge of Stage V and Tier 4 Final engine control systems would be an advantage.
